What Is a Battery Circular Saw?A battery circular saw is a power saw that uses a circular blade to cut through wood, metal, and other products. Unlike standard corded circular saws, these battery-operated variations use the versatility of motion without being tethered to a power outlet. This makes them especially appealing for outdoor tasks, renovations, and task websites where electrical access may be limited.
Secret Features of Battery Circular SawsWhen selecting a battery circular saw, there are numerous necessary features that users need to consider.
FeatureDescriptionBlade SizeTypical sizes include 6.5-inch, 7.25-inch, and 8.25-inch blades.RPM (Revolutions Per Minute)Generally ranges from 3,500 to 5,800 RPM, impacting cutting speed.Cutting DepthFigures out how thick products can be cut; generally varies from 2 to 3.5 inches.WeightBattery saws normally weigh between 5 to 12 pounds.Battery TypeMany use lithium-ion batteries for better performance and durability.Brushless MotorOffers better effectiveness, more power, and longer life-span.Advantages of Battery Circular Saws1. Intended Use
Comprehend what kinds of jobs you'll be dealing with. For light DIY tasks, a smaller and less powerful model may be sufficient, however experts or those dealing with heavy-duty tasks might need a more robust tool.
2. Battery Compatibility
Some brand names offer tools that share battery packs. If you currently own a battery from a particular manufacturer, consider a circular saw that utilizes the same battery to save money on extra purchases.
3. Blade Type
Various blade types serve various cutting functions. A general-purpose blade works for most applications, while specialized blades are offered for tasks like cutting metal or ending up work.
4. Price Point
Battery circular saws come in a wide variety of rates. While higher-end models frequently provide better features and longer battery life, several affordable alternatives can efficiently satisfy most needs.
5. Brand Reputation
Research study brand names and check out user reviews. Trusted companies typically supply much better guarantees and client service, which can be essential in making sure long-lasting complete satisfaction with the tool.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: How long does the battery last?
A: Battery life can differ based upon the saw's power needs and the type of work being done. Most lithium-ion batteries last in between 30-120 minutes, depending on use.
Q2: Can I replace the battery?
A: Yes, in many cases, batteries are replaceable. Look for brand names that offer compatible batteries across multiple tools.
Q3: What is the average rate of a battery circular saw?
A: Prices normally v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300, depending upon the brand, functions, and consisted of devices.
Q4: Is it safe to use a battery circular saw inside your home?
A: Yes, battery saws can be securely used inside as they produce less sound and do not discharge fumes.
Q5: Can a battery circular saw cut through metal?
A: Yes, however it requires a customized metal-cutting blade to ensure efficiency and security.
